The tension on a rope causing the box to accelerate is 30 N.

Tension on the rope

The tension experienced by the rope pulling the mass at the given acceleration is determined by applying Newton's second law of motion as shown below;

T = ma

where;

  • m is the mass of the object
  • a is the acceleration of the object

T = 7.5 x 4

T = 30 N

Thus, the tension on a rope causing the box to accelerate is 30 N.
